Estimation of the parameters of nonequilibrium grain boundaries from the high-temperature background of grain boundary internal friction

Abstract: The physical processes leading to the formation of nonequilibrium grain boundaries in nanocrystalline and ultrafine-grained materials are considered. The problem is solved for a two-dimensional diffusion equation on a boundary segment exposed to variable compressive stresses. The vacancy distribution and the corresponding normal tension in the segment are found. From the consideration of vacancy dynamics, the rate of mutual displacement of grains in the normal to the boundary direction and the amount of internal friction are determined. Internal friction has the character of a high-temperature background. The effect of stress adjustment is taken into account. The process of atomic relaxation of the boundary structure over time is discussed. The change in relaxation energy is shown with a change in a complex parameter, including frequency, grain size, activation energy, and temperature. From the graph of the dependence of the logarithm of the product of internal friction on temperature on the reverse temperature, the activation energies on the high- and low-temperature parts of the process are found. It is shown that at pre-melting temperatures, areas with the highest activation energy may appear. A method for determining the activation energy of internal friction at equilibrium and nonequilibrium boundaries is considered. The method of grain size estimation is discussed. The relaxation time of the atomic structure of the boundary can be determined from the change in the amount of internal friction over time.
